On a lovely Sunday morning, two Goodgymmers ventured forth inthe depths of southeast Lewisham to assist Ms M to clear her front garden of pesky weeds & rubbish.

When we arrived, Ms M greeted us showing us what was to be kept and what wasn't and then began the journey of a thousand shovels!!

Firstly we got to removal of the long grass and weeds using the rake to expose the roots for easy removal. Then came to turning of the soil for fresh planting in spring.

After only an hour & a half we bid Ms M a fond farewell and skipped happily back to the city direction
